Обычно так, но ты можешь называть исходники как хочешь (но лучше не надо). Компилятору насрать.
.h - это кусок текста C/C++, включается в cpp препроцессором через #include, никакой семантической нагрузки не несет в языке С/C++
.h - может быть как и Си, так и С++
Обсуждают сегодня